mysql创建数据表密码md5加密sql语句
时间: 2023-09-11 12:07:01
浏览: 110
你可以使用以下SQL语句在MySQL中创建一个密码字段,并将密码进行[md5](https://geek.csdn.net/educolumn/08dea776b57775aebc1c5521be489bb7?spm=1055.2569.3001.10083)加密:
```sql
CREATE TABLE users (
id INT(11) NOT NULL AUTO_INCREMENT,
username VARCHAR(50) NOT NULL,
password VARCHAR(50) NOT NULL,
PRIMARY KEY (id)
INSERT INTO users (username, password) VALUES ('john', [md5](https://geek.csdn.net/educolumn/08dea776b57775aebc1c5521be489bb7?spm=1055.2569.3001.10083)('password'));
在上面的例子中,我们创建了一个名为users的数据表,其中包含id、username和password三个字段。password字段将存储用户密码的[md5](https://geek.csdn.net/educolumn/08dea776b57775aebc1c5521be489bb7?spm=1055.2569.3001.10083)哈希值。在插入数据时,我们使用[md5](https://geek.csdn.net/educolumn/08dea776b57775aebc1c5521be489bb7?spm=1055.2569.3001.10083)[函数](https://geek.csdn.net/educolumn/ba94496e6cfa8630df5d047358ad9719?dp_token=eyJ0eXAiOiJKV1QiLCJhbGciOiJIUzI1NiJ9.eyJpZCI6NDQ0MDg2MiwiZXhwIjoxNzA3MzcxOTM4LCJpYXQiOjE3MDY3NjcxMzgsInVzZXJuYW1lIjoid2VpeGluXzY4NjQ1NjQ1In0.RrTYEnMNYPC7AQdoij4SBb0kKEgHoyvF-bZOG2eGQvc&spm=1055.2569.3001.10083)将密码加密并将其插入到password字段中。
相关问题
mysql创建用户密码表
你可以使用以下语句在MySQL中创建一个用户密码表:
```sql
CREATE TABLE users (
id INT PRIMARY KEY AUTO_INCREMENT,
username VARCHAR(50) NOT NULL,
password VARCHAR(255) NOT NULL
```
给我随机生成一段sql语句来创建表
当然可以,这里是一个简单的SQL语句示例,用于在MySQL中创建一个名为"users"的用户表,包含id、username和email字段:
```sql
CREATE TABLE users (
id INT AUTO_INCREMENT,
```